Default Transmission regrets?

Anyone here regret running a powerglide in their Strip/street car? Heavy on the strip side of things. I'm looking really hard at the FTI level 4 Glide, and going with PTC for a converter.

#3,100 race weight
5.3, LJMS stage2 turbo cam
S475, 20-25psi
MS3PRO
E85
275/60/15
Rear gears to be determined

Sounds perfect for a glide.
Street driving a glide is the same as street driving a 400. Both have final ratio of 1:1 so when you're cruising it'll be the same.
Their level 3 would hold the power no problem...but the stock case would worry me. Go with the level 4 and get the SFI case.

My first regret building my car was actually buying a 400 instead of a glide. Because I fell into the "it wont be as streetable with a glide"

Just like the gentleman above me said. Its still 1:1 in high gear.

i absolutely love the glide on and off the street.

1.76 ratio is GM's heavy duty planetary that can be used in drag racing. The aftermarket 1.80 straight cut is primarily used for drag racing.

Got my glide yesterday. Looks great inside. Has a 10clutch direct drum, 300m th400 input shaft, Hughes aftermarket 1.76 planetary gear set, Hughes transbrake manual reverse valve body, ATI transbrake solenoid, deep pan, machined for JW ultrabell, scattershield. Those are the major things, I'm sure I'm forgetting something. Anyway got it bought for $650. I know the case is the weak link but just can't do a $3,500+ aftermarket case glide right now. Hopefully this one will hold some power for a while.
